The video introduces the concept of probability, explaining it as a measure of uncertainty. It uses examples like coin tosses, dice rolls, and card draws to illustrate how probability is calculated. The video also discusses complementary events and real-world applications, such as predicting weather probabilities. The aim is to make the concept of probability clear and applicable to everyday situations.
